2. Regulatory and Compliance Information

Real Forex operates without any regulatory oversight, which raises significant concerns regarding its legitimacy. The lack of regulation means that there are no governing bodies ensuring that the broker adheres to industry standards or protects clients' funds. According to available information, Real Forex does not hold a license from any recognized regulatory authority, which is a critical aspect for traders to consider when selecting a broker.

The absence of a regulatory framework also means that there are no specific regulatory numbers or licenses that clients can verify. In terms of client fund protection, Real Forex claims to maintain segregated accounts; however, without regulatory oversight, this claim cannot be independently verified.

Real Forex does not participate in any investor compensation schemes, which typically provide a safety net for clients in case of broker insolvency. Furthermore, the broker's compliance with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) regulations is unclear, potentially exposing clients to risks associated with fraudulent activities.

5. Account Types and Trading Conditions

Real Forex offers several account types to cater to different trading needs:

  • Standard Account: Requires a minimum deposit of $2,000, with variable spreads starting at 2.1 pips on major currency pairs. No commission is charged on trades.
  • VIP Account: Designed for high-volume traders, this account type necessitates a minimum deposit of $10,000 and offers tighter spreads and enhanced trading conditions.
  • Institutional Account: Tailored for institutional clients, this account requires a minimum deposit of $50,000, and leverage can be negotiated based on the client's trading volume.

The broker allows for a maximum leverage of 1:200, which is relatively standard in the industry. The minimum trade size varies depending on the account type, with specific policies in place for overnight fees and margin requirements.

Real Forex also provides a demo account option, allowing prospective clients to practice trading without risking real capital. This account is beneficial for new traders looking to familiarize themselves with the platform and trading strategies.

6. Fund Management

Real Forex supports various deposit methods, including bank wire transfers and credit cards. The minimum deposit requirement varies by account type, with the standard account requiring at least $2,000.

Deposit processing times are generally prompt, but specific durations are not explicitly stated by the broker. There are no fees associated with deposits, which is an advantage for clients looking to maximize their trading capital.

For withdrawals, clients can utilize the same methods as deposits. However, the broker does not provide clear information regarding withdrawal fees or processing times, which can be a potential drawback for traders accustomed to transparency in these areas.
